news 2026/4/16 17:10:03

XiYan-SQL自然语言SQL转换框架完整安装指南

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
XiYan-SQL自然语言SQL转换框架完整安装指南

XiYan-SQL自然语言SQL转换框架完整安装指南

【免费下载链接】XiYan-SQLA MULTI-GENERATOR ENSEMBLE FRAMEWORK FOR NATURAL LANGUAGE TO SQL项目地址: https://gitcode.com/gh_mirrors/xiy/XiYan-SQL

XiYan-SQL作为前沿的自然语言SQL转换框架,通过多生成器集成策略显著提升了SQL生成质量。本指南将帮助您快速完成安装配置,体验这一创新SQL生成框架的强大功能。

🚀 快速安装流程

环境准备检查

在开始安装之前,请确保您的系统已安装以下必备组件:

  • Python 3.6或更高版本
  • pip包管理器
  • git版本控制系统

项目获取与部署

第一步是获取项目源代码,执行以下命令:

git clone https://gitcode.com/gh_mirrors/xiy/XiYan-SQL cd XiYan-SQL

依赖包安装配置

进入项目目录后,安装必要的依赖包:

pip install -r requirements.txt

此步骤将自动配置XiYan-SQL运行所需的所有Python库和环境组件。

⚙️ 核心功能配置详解

M-Schema模式配置

M-Schema作为半结构化的数据库模式表示方法,是XiYan-SQL框架的核心组件。它会自动处理数据库结构理解,无需手动配置。

模型组件初始化

框架包含多个专用模型:

  • XiYanSQL-QwenCoder系列:专门用于SQL生成的不同尺寸模型
  • DateResolver:增强中文日期理解和推理的模型
  • 集成策略:多生成器集成策略确保候选SQL质量

数据库连接设置

根据您的数据库类型,可能需要配置连接参数。XiYan-SQL支持主流数据库系统,包括MySQL、PostgreSQL等。

🎯 验证安装效果

基本功能测试

安装完成后,建议运行项目提供的测试用例来验证安装效果。这些测试将检查:

  • 模型加载状态
  • SQL生成功能
  • 数据库连接能力

性能基准验证

参考项目文档中的性能基准测试,对比XiYan-SQL在Bird、Spider、SQL-Eval等标准测试集上的表现。

🔧 常见问题排查

依赖冲突解决

如遇到依赖包版本冲突,建议创建独立的Python虚拟环境:

python -m venv xiyan-env source xiyan-env/bin/activate pip install -r requirements.txt

模型加载问题

如果模型加载失败,请检查:

  • 网络连接状态
  • 磁盘空间充足性
  • 系统内存可用性

📈 进阶使用建议

优化配置策略

根据您的具体使用场景,可以调整以下参数:

  • 模型尺寸选择(3B/7B/14B/32B)
  • 生成器数量配置
  • 结果选择策略

扩展功能探索

XiYan-SQL还提供多种扩展功能:

  • 数据库描述自动生成
  • 多方言SQL支持
  • 复杂查询处理

通过以上步骤,您已成功安装并配置了XiYan-SQL自然语言SQL转换框架。现在可以开始探索这一创新工具在SQL生成任务中的强大能力。

【免费下载链接】XiYan-SQLA MULTI-GENERATOR ENSEMBLE FRAMEWORK FOR NATURAL LANGUAGE TO SQL项目地址: https://gitcode.com/gh_mirrors/xiy/XiYan-SQL

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/16 16:35:22

MobileCLIP终极指南:新手快速上手的简单方法

MobileCLIP终极指南:新手快速上手的简单方法 【免费下载链接】ml-mobileclip This repository contains the official implementation of the research paper, "MobileCLIP: Fast Image-Text Models through Multi-Modal Reinforced Training" CVPR 2024 …

作者头像 李华
网站建设 2026/4/16 14:05:43

Red Hat Enterprise Linux 7.0 完整获取与安装解决方案

Red Hat Enterprise Linux 7.0 完整获取与安装解决方案 【免费下载链接】RedHatEnterpriseLinux7.0镜像ISO下载指南 本仓库提供 Red Hat Enterprise Linux 7.0 镜像 ISO 文件的下载链接,方便用户快速获取并安装该操作系统。该镜像文件存储在百度网盘中,用…

作者头像 李华
网站建设 2026/4/16 12:25:54

30分钟实战!从零部署深度相机到嵌入式平台的完整指南

你是否正在为嵌入式设备集成深度感知功能而烦恼?面对复杂的内核编译和硬件兼容性问题,很多开发者望而却步。本文将为你提供一条清晰的部署路径,让你在30分钟内完成从环境配置到深度数据采集的全流程操作。 【免费下载链接】librealsense Inte…

作者头像 李华
网站建设 2026/4/16 12:27:48

Stegsolve:专业图像隐写分析与数字取证工具完全指南

Stegsolve是一款功能强大的开源图像隐写分析工具,专为图像安全和数字取证领域设计。这款基于Java开发的跨平台软件,能够帮助用户发现隐藏在图像中的秘密信息,是网络安全爱好者和数字取证专家的必备利器。 【免费下载链接】Stegsolve.jar下载与…

作者头像 李华
网站建设 2026/4/16 12:20:33

hal_uart_transmit中断传输稳定性提升方法

如何让hal_uart_transmit中断发送不再丢数据?一个稳定可靠的 UART 发送框架设计你有没有遇到过这种情况:在用 STM32 的 HAL 库调用HAL_UART_Transmit_IT()发送数据时,连续发几包就出问题——有的包没发出去、有的被截断、甚至系统直接卡死&am…

作者头像 李华
网站建设 2026/4/16 12:17:44

Open-AutoGLM部署核心技巧曝光:3步实现高性能推理服务搭建

第一章:Open-AutoGLM部署概述Open-AutoGLM 是一个基于 GLM 大语言模型架构的开源自动化推理与生成系统,专为高效部署、灵活扩展和低延迟响应设计。其核心目标是将自然语言处理能力无缝集成至企业级应用中,支持从本地开发到云原生环境的全链路…

作者头像 李华